How they compare
OECD members currently reports 11.87 billion SIPRI trend indicator values against 982.00 million SIPRI trend indicator values in Pakistan, a difference of 10.89 billion SIPRI trend indicator values.
That makes OECD members's figure about 12.1 times Pakistan's.
Across all 65 years both countries report, OECD members has been ahead every year.
OECD members ranks 6th and Pakistan ranks 9th of 43 groups.
OECD members has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

About this data
Arms transfers (imports) cover the volume of transfers of major arms through sales and gifts, and those made through manufacturing licenses. Data cover major conventional weapons such as aircraft, armored vehicles, artillery, radar systems, missiles, and ships. Figures are SIPRI Trend Indicator Values (TIVs). A '0' indicates that the volume of deliveries is between 0 and 0.5 million SIPRI TIV.
